In a bank, a security camera is placed 10 feet high on a wall that is 45 feet from the front door. What angle of depression is needed so the camera aims for a point at the base of the front door?

Let's start by drawing a diagram of this situation

We can calculate the angle of depression using the following trigonometric function:


\tan (\theta)=(10)/(45)

Let's solve for theta


\begin{gathered} \theta=\arctan \mleft((10)/(45)\mright) \\ \theta=0.21866=12.53^(\circ\: ) \end{gathered}
